      <title>Ctrl-Shift-Tab</title>
      <link>http://www.mapleprimes.com/questions/131431-Shortcut-Key-To-Flip-Between-Tabs?ref=Feed:MaplePrimes:Shortcut Key to Flip Between Tabs:Comments#answer131449</link>
      <itunes:summary>&lt;p&gt;On Linux, Ctrl-Shift-Tab works.&amp;nbsp; Alternatively, you can do Alt-w #, where # is the tab number.&lt;/p&gt;</itunes:summary>

      <title>Introduced in Maple 15</title>
      <link>http://www.mapleprimes.com/questions/131431-Shortcut-Key-To-Flip-Between-Tabs?ref=Feed:MaplePrimes:Shortcut Key to Flip Between Tabs:Comments#answer131465</link>
      <itunes:summary>&lt;p&gt;For Windows at least, the CTRL+TAB (forward) or CTRL+SHIFT+TAB (revese) shortcut keys for switching between tabs were introduced in Maple 15.&amp;nbsp; These are not available in 13.&amp;nbsp; The only option for 13 is to use Joe's Alt-W technique.&lt;/p&gt;
